Why Trucking Companies in Sandy Springs Face Unique Funding Challenges

Trucking operations around Sandy Springs encounter capital obstacles that office-based businesses never see. The Perimeter district generates constant demand for last-mile delivery and regional freight, yet lenders often balk at the combination of expensive rolling assets, fuel price swings, and maintenance cycles that can ground revenue overnight. A Class 8 tractor costs what many small warehouses do, but it depreciates faster and sits on a title instead of a deed. Owner-operators launching from Sandy Springs to serve the Hartsfield-Jackson cargo network need working capital between invoice payment cycles that stretch 30 to 60 days, while parts suppliers in Chamblee and Doraville expect cash on pickup.

Which Loan Programs Fit Trucking Operations Best

Small trucking business loans come in several structures, each solving a different cash need. SBA 7(a) loans finance truck purchases, trailer acquisitions, and working capital under one package when you're expanding routes or buying out a partner. Equipment financing isolates the collateral to the truck itself, keeping your other assets free and often moving faster than blanket liens. A business line of credit covers fuel, permits, and payroll gaps between invoice settlements. Invoice factoring converts unpaid freight bills into immediate cash without adding debt to your balance sheet, critical when brokers in Smyrna or Norcross pay net-45.

Start-Up Trucking Business Loans and Owner-Operator Financing

Start up trucking business loans and owner operator trucking loans address the cold-start problem: you need a truck to win contracts, but you need contracts to qualify for truck financing. We broker relationships with lenders who evaluate your CDL history, freight-lane density around Sandy Springs, and pre-agreements with shippers instead of requiring two years of corporate tax returns.

What types of loans are available for trucking companies in Sandy Springs?+
Small business loans for trucking companies include SBA 7(a) for growth and acquisition, equipment financing for trucks and trailers, working capital lines for fuel and payroll, and invoice factoring to convert freight bills into immediate cash. Each program addresses different operating needs, from fleet expansion to short-term liquidity.
How do I get a loan to start a trucking business in Sandy Springs?+
How to get a loan to start a trucking company begins with documenting your CDL credentials, freight contracts or letters of intent, and a business plan that shows lane density and shipper demand around Sandy Springs. Brokers like Driftwood present these to lenders experienced in trucking company start up loans, who weigh industry expertise over lengthy operating history.
Can owner-operators secure financing without a large down payment?+
Many owner operator trucking loans require 10 to 20 percent down, though the exact amount depends on your credit profile, the truck's age, and existing contracts. Lenders may reduce down-payment requirements if you provide strong safety scores and documented freight agreements with local shippers in Marietta, Vinings, or North Druid Hills.
What collateral do lenders require for trucking company financing?+
Business loan for trucking company collateral typically includes the financed equipment itself (truck, trailer, or both), and sometimes a blanket lien on business assets. Invoice factoring uses your accounts receivable as collateral. SBA 7(a) loans may require personal guarantees from owners holding 20 percent or more equity.
How long does approval take for trucking business loans?+
Approval timelines range from 48 hours for invoice factoring to four weeks for SBA 7(a) products. Equipment financing often closes in one to two weeks. Do I need perfect credit to qualify for start-up trucking loans?+
Start up trucking loans evaluate credit alongside industry experience, safety records, and freight commitments. Lenders accept credit scores in the mid-600s when other factors are strong.
